
16-bit, 570 kSPS CMOS PulSAR® Analog-to-Digital Converter (ADC) featuring a single channel and differential input. Achieves 1.5 LSB Differential Nonlinearity and 2.5 LSB Integral Nonlinearity with no missing codes. Operates with a 2.3V to 3.15V input voltage range and offers an SPI interface. This unipolar ADC boasts a 90dB Signal-to-Noise Ratio and a maximum power dissipation of 115mW. Packaged in LQFP, it is RoHS compliant and suitable for operation between -40°C and 85°C.
